The most fascinating aspect of Kishore Kumar’s legacy is the contrast between his public persona and his deepest musical expressions. He was a master of yodeling, a comic genius, and a man known for his onscreen antics. Yet, when tasked with delivering songs of profound loneliness, betrayal, or existential grief, he accessed an emotional depth that few trained classical singers could match.

Under the Indian Copyright Act, 1957 (amended 2012), sound recordings remain protected for 60 years from the publication year. Most of Kishore Kumar's iconic sad songs were recorded in the 1960s–1980s, meaning copyright is still active under Saregama, Universal Music, and other labels. Downloading MP3s from unauthorized sites (e.g., pagalworld, mp3mad) constitutes infringement, punishable under Section 63 with imprisonment up to 3 years.

The widespread adoption of MP3 technology in the 1990s revolutionized the music industry. MP3 files, which use compression algorithms to reduce file sizes, made it easier to store and share large collections of music. However, this convenience also led to a surge in music piracy.
